### RestockPilot: Release Prerequisites

Before cutting a release, confirm that the RestockPilot planner can reach the SnackGrid inventory service, since the build pipeline runs an integration smoke test against staging during packaging. A failed handshake here blocks the release tag, so verify credentials first. The pipeline reads its staging credential from the deploy config; for reference and manual verification, the current key appears below.

service key, tajof-fawip: vxb4-JNOz

## Tuning

The Granford timetable solver (project Chalkline) uses simulated annealing over teacher, room, and cohort constraints. Runtime scales sharply with cooling rate and restart count, so the defaults target a full secondary-school schedule in under ten minutes on a single worker. Hard-constraint weights must stay at least an order of magnitude above soft ones, or the solver trades clashes for preferences. When reviewing changes, verify they keep these defaults intact.

tuning table, kajog-kawef:
PRIORITIES = {
    "kelox": 870,
    "kasix": 89,
    "eliax": 988,
}

## Authentication

Tilegrab prefetches map tiles from the Cartovane render cluster ahead of offline deployments. All requests to the tile endpoint must carry a bearer token issued by the Cartovane ops console; unauthenticated calls are rejected with a 401 and counted against the abuse quota. Tokens rotate each release cycle, so verify the active one before cutting a build. The current staging token is:

session JWT of yawep-yawep = eyJhbGciOiJIUzI1NiIsInR5cCI6IkpXVCJ9.eyJzdWIiOiI3pWF3_In0.aXYsHiog

## Deploying the Gatewick Proctor Queue

Deploys are pretty painless: push to main, wait for the pipeline, then watch the queue drain dashboard for five minutes. If candidates pile up mid-exam, roll back first and ask questions later — the queue replays safely. Everything the workers care about lives in one config block, shown here for reference.

settings of bafof-yagef:
JOROX_PIN=8740
JOROX_TENANT=pelox
JOROX_METRICS_HOST=metrics.jorox.qorvelworks.internal
JOROX_SEAL=seal_c78f63c1
JOROX_STANDBY_TEAM=norax